My name is Gui Pinto. For my day job I work for Adobe, solving problems and writing software for Adobe’s e-commerce platform. However, for my first career from the mid 80’s to the mid 90’s, I was a photojournalist working in Brazil for O Globo and Caras, a daily newspaper and a weekly magazine respectively, before moving to the United States.
I love photography. I love writing. So here I’ll be posting my pictures and writing about them. So the stories will also be about my whereabouts, as my photography is documentary by nature.
